Below you will find some information about the natural features of the beaches of Ballipinar, we hope that this information will help you find the place of your dreams.

The beaches of village are mainly wide. According to reviews of major beach experts and vacationers, most beaches have a low level of cleanliness. Sandy beaches dominate the rest!

Usually, the depth increases normally. If this is important to you, always use our filter to check for a particular beach.

8 out of 15 beaches in Ballipinar are partially protected from waves. These protections can be natural or man-made structures. The warmest month during the year in this area is August, with the air temperature rising up to 26.1°C and the water temperature up to 23.5°C. The coldest month is January, with the air temperature dropping down to 9.8°C and the water temperature down to 11.2°C.
